Overnight Digest: Stocks to Watch on March 16, 2026

Equity markets closed in the red today, and it was also one of the worst weeks for Dalal Street. All indices traded lower due to tensions in the Middle East, rising crude oil prices, inflationary pressures, and the outflow of FIIs from India.

The Nifty 50 opened with a gap down of 176 points and extended its losses throughout the trading session. The index eventually closed below the 23,200 mark, hitting a fresh 10-month low. At the closing bell, the Nifty 50 fell by 488.05 points, or 2.06 per cent, to settle at 23,151.10.

The Sensex declined by 1,470.50 points, or 1.93 per cent, ending at 74,563.92.

  1. Tata Motors Ltd –
    Tata Motors has secured orders for over 5,000 buses from multiple State Transport Undertakings. These orders come from MSRTC (Maharashtra), GSRTC (Gujarat), NWKRTC (North Western Karnataka), TGSRTC (Telangana), BSRTC (Bihar), RSRTC (Rajasthan), KSRTC (Kerala), Haryana Roadways, and CTU (Chandigarh). The orders cover a wide range of passenger vehicles, including Tata Magna, Tata Cityride, Tata Starbus, Tata Starbus Prime, and LPO 1618, 1622, and 1822 models. These buses and chassis are designed for intercity, long-haul, and intracity operations.
    Tata Motors Ltd closed at Rs 425.65, down Rs 17.90 or 4.04 per cent from the previous close of Rs 443.55. The stock opened at Rs 439.00 and traded in a wide range, hitting a low of Rs 418.00 and a high of Rs 442.15.

 

  1. Krystal Integrated Services Ltd –
    Krystal Integrated Services has received a contract from Tamil Nadu Medical Services Corporation. The company will provide housekeeping, security, and other services to various government medical institutions under the Directorate of Medical and Rural Health Services (DMRHS), ESI, and the Commissionerate of Indian Medicine and Homeopathy. The contract is for three years and is valued at around Rs 364 crore.
    Krystal Integrated Services Ltd closed at Rs 569.35, down Rs 15.70 or 2.68 per cent from the previous close of Rs 585.05. The stock opened at Rs 584.50 and touched an Intraday high of Rs 612.30 before falling to a low of Rs 565.05.

 

  1. Organic Recycling Systems Ltd –
    Organic Recycling Systems (ORSL) has acquired Industrial Associate, a chemical trading firm with long-standing relationships with leading manufacturers and industrial clients across multiple sectors. This acquisition strengthens ORSL’s green chemicals and sustainable materials division. It will help the company integrate circular economy solutions into industrial chemical supply chains.
    Organic Recycling Systems Ltd closed at Rs 236.50, up slightly by Rs 0.15 or 0.06 per cent from the previous close of Rs 236.35. The stock opened lower at Rs 233.60 and steadily recovered to reach the session high of Rs 236.50.

 

  1. Pee Cee Cosma Sope Ltd –
    The Executive Committee of Pee Cee Cosma Sope Ltd approved the incorporation of a wholly owned subsidiary today, March 13, 2026. The new company will be called “Pee Cee Energy and Reality Limited”. It will operate in the energy, Real Estate, and related trading of materials.

Pee Cee Cosma Sope Ltd closed at Rs 322.80, up Rs 3.25 or 1.02 per cent from the previous close of Rs 319.55. The stock opened higher at Rs 329.80 but fell during the session to hit a low of Rs 313.50, before recovering slightly.
